107 quotations in Children & Parents in English

 

"Ask your child what he wants for dinner only if he is buying."

Fran Lebowitz

"Children are unpredictable. You never know what inconsistency they're going to catch you in next."

Franklin P. Jones

"Children aren't happy without something to ignore,
And that's what parents were created for."

Ogden Nash, American poet
The Parents

"I stopped believing in Santa Claus when I was six. Mother took me to see him in a department store and he asked for my autograph."

Shirley Temple

"Parents are traffic signs that are always in our blind spots."

Jeremy Preston Johnson

"Setting an example for your children takes all the fun out of middle age."

William Feather, Sr.

"The face of a child can say it all, especially the mouth part of the face."

Jack Handey

"The first half of our lives is ruined by our parents, and the second half by our children."

Clarence Darrow

"We spend the first twelve months of our children's lives teaching them to walk and talk and the next twelve telling them to sit down and shut up."

Phyllis Diller

"You can learn many things from children. How much patience you have, for instance."

Franklin P. Jones
